Conference Call Tips: A Common Sense Guide

No matter how often you speak on conference calls, a simple reminder or look at do's and don'ts can assist you with your next conference call. These conference call tips have been proven to eliminate annoyances and help you to convey the professionalism you desire. We will take a look at some conference call mistakes and how to avoid them.

1.Never use a cell phone to join a conference call. The only exception being if you are inside a car and everyone on the call knows you will be joining from the road.

2.Make sure the phone you are using has no static or other interference. There's nothing more distracting than someone's phone emitting strange noises, detracting from the year end review.

3.If you are a work from home employee, plan on immobilizing yourself for the duration of the call. Don't wash the dishes while the boss is detailing the fiscal year finances. It can really dry up your career potential if they hear that water splashing.

4.Know your devices. If you're using a speakerphone, know what buttons to push to mute the speaker. In fact, use the mute button to eliminate the chance of your coffee spilling onto your laptop and the explicative flying from your mouth. If you're using a headset, become accustomed to it before doing your first conference call. Know how the mute button works and test it out. It's better to be prepared then telling everyone how miserable you are on the call, when you thought only your coworker would hear.

5.Know the times and agenda for each meeting before calling in to the call. This conference call tips will help you to stay focused throughout the call and not talk about something unrelated, when you believed you were involved on a different call.

6.Take notes, but try to do it on paper, not with the clacking of the laptop keys resounding in the speakerphone. If you must use your laptop, mute the microphone until you need to be heard. After all, you can't take notes while you're speaking.

7.If there are a lot of people on the conference call, introduce yourself when you speak. It can be done without much formality, but its better they know who is sharing the golden idea, before someone else slips in to take credit.

There are many conference call tips that can assist you in dealing with behaviors and appearances. It is important to remember to use common sense. The best conference call tips come from knowing yourself and your own limitations. By being professional, courteous, and insightful on the conference call, the rest will just fall into place.

Tips in Organizing an Audio Conference Call

Audio conference calls are widely used these days. It is used to increase a business' productivity, as well as its market sales. This technology is applicable to businesses that have a need for a multi-party telephone conversation. Audio conference calls make it possible for an executive to confer with their colleagues in different places and different countries even, all at the same time. Audio and web conferencing is usually used during a multinational firm's quarterly or year-end meetings.

If you have a business and want to take advantage of an audio conference call, either to boost your sales or make a dent in the market, here are four tips you can follow on how to properly conduct a conference call.

1. Make an audio conference call checklist. The checklist should outline the things you have to do to ensure that the whole affair will go smoothly. Make sure that you have listed all required attendees and have confirmed their availability. You have to make sure that participants have their own dial-in numbers and passwords as well.

2. Organize your meeting agenda. Make a list of all the topics that you intend to discuss during the conference. You should also allot the necessary minutes for each and follow it strictly. The chairperson has to be properly informed of all of it too.

3. Assign a person that will make the minutes of the meeting. The meeting minutes should include the date and time the meeting took place. All the attendees should also be listed in there, as well as the topic of discussion. The keeper of the meeting minutes should accurately list what transpired in the meeting and what comments are added by which attendees.

4. Distribute a feedback form. The feedback form would allow the attendees to air their views and what they felt about the audio conference call in general. They would have the chance to tell their comments and questions about the topics discussed. The feedback form would also give them the chance to suggest some topics that were not covered, so that it will be taken into consideration the next time around. Most importantly, they will be able to give out their proposals on how the next conference call can be improved for the better. They should also be presented the option to give out their name and contact number if they choose to.

All About Earnings Conference Call

Earnings conference calls are the means of companies to communicate information to all those that are concerned. These concerned parties include investors that are either institutional or merely individual. Earnings conference calls permit businesses to magnify their reached success and provide composure when the company experience trouble. Oftentimes, these earnings conference calls are held right after the dissemination of financial outcomes. This usually happens at the last part of each quarter. Thus, the name quarterly earnings-results conference calls.

After telling of the financial results' news, a facilitator, or the person that conducts the earnings conference calls, presents the assortments of the participants of the conference. The master of the ceremonies begins by introducing the vice-president. What commonly happens is that this vice-president outlines the directions of the call or agenda. The business future is being more like crafted through the predictions that these earnings conference calls make. Prospecting or future-directed statements are being emphasized to make the investors keep in mind that not all that will be discussed during the call will certainly concretize.

Those that are often taking part with earnings conference calls are those that handle top positions in the company. These are the CEO, chairman, CFO, and subject to the events that will be talked about, other executives may also play a part during these calls. This is because these are the ones that can convey information on the general operations of the company that affected its financial standing. A synopsis of the business・performance may be provided through their assistance. Presumptions on the company's future also become major parts of the important ideas that the participants will be discussing.

Earnings conference calls traditionally end with an open forum that usually consists of a question and answer portion. This is when the business analysts and investors are given the chance to air their queries and other concerns that may lead to the betterment of the company's financial status or may plainly clarify some blurry ideas.

It is through real time Internet transmission that gave chance for average investors to utilize earnings conference calls as a medium to be more updated with the goings-on of the company. Investors may either participate through discussing some points or simply by listening to the calls. These investors are commonly found in the investor relation fragment of websites put up by the companies themselves. Aside from informing a company's current investors on what's happening, earnings conference calls can relay enough information that may attract more investors. It is essential that one must remember that these calls are not done just for any reason. Individual investors may not be privileged to participate in the answer and question part. But absorbing the essence of reports on the current financial status of the companies sparks more valuable ideas that may aid in their future investment endeavors. Top management does not allow these earnings conference calls to detriment the company. It is wise to understand that the cause and means of the improvement or destruction of the company are not simply divulged to satisfy the curiosity of prying people. Earnings conference calls are aimed at arriving with the best solution if ever dilemmas are presented.

These conference calls are usually rebroadcast on the website of the company for a few weeks.

Choosing A Flat Rate Conference Call Plan

Choosing a flat rate conference call is a smart choice for today's businesses. While it is easy to justify the benefits of services offered by conference call providers, it is important to realize that just like any other business expense it is important to review that cost and ensure that is actually providing a benefit for the company. When choosing a service provider read the contracts and service plans carefully. If the charge is not based on a flat rate, chances are you will be better off moving along elsewhere.

If the fees and charges aren't clearly stated very early on there is a high chance that there are hidden fees that can really make conferencing expenses skyrocket. It is very important when seeking out flat rate conference call providers to review all of the potential charges and the wording of the conference-calling plan. It is unfortunate, but there are a lot of service providers that are not truly interested in providing a valuable service, they are only interested in making money quickly. Providers like that will look for any way to increase the amount of the charges.

The way a flat rate conference call works, is you choose your basic level of service and then the rate is determined from that point. Basic service choices start with the calling method. Are the attendees able to call a toll free number with a pass code? Does an operator who then assists the attendee in connecting answer the toll free number? If the service uses an operator it is possible that the charges will be higher. If the callers are not given a toll free number to call, verify just what services are being paid for.

Once the services needed have been decided on, the flat will now be determined. In most cases the flat rate is basically a set amount charged per caller per minute. For example if you expect about 150 attendees at a conference, you may be charged $.10 per caller per minute. A sixty-minute call is then going to cost $900 with each caller costing a total of $6.00. Keep in mind that this example is an over simplification. If expected attendance is over a certain level you are usually eligible for a discount. Conference Call

A conference is an arranged meeting, consultation or discussion. A conference call is a call wherein three or more parties interact simultaneously. Modes of communication not only include telephones, but also video and web communication. Conference calls are widely used by companies to facilitate meetings or to distribute information. It?s a cost-effective way to reduce travel expenses and stay connected to one?s counterparts all over the globe.

There are two basic types of conferencing: MeetMe conferencing, in which each participant dials one number, and Ad Hoc conferencing, in which a moderator calls each participant. In recent times, conference calls have become very advanced and user-friendly. The conference call can be designed to allow the dialed party to talk during the call, or the call may be set up so that the called party can listen into the call but cannot speak.

Conference calls connect people through a conference bridge, which is basically a server that acts like a telephone and can answer multiple calls at the same time. Companies using Voice over IP (VoIP) telephones can also host conference calls themselves if the VoIP software supports them.

Businesses use conference calls the most. Banks and brokerages frequently use conference calls for the mass distribution of status reports. Conference calls are used by many businesses to facilitate communication between coworkers. Conference calls are also used to report quarterly results.

Conference calls can also be used for entertainment or recreational purposes, such as the party line in which people can call in to a specified telephone number to talk to others and perhaps subsequently meet new people.

Thus, conference calls not only help businesses network without any constraints, but are also cost-effective. Conference calling is now utilized regularly by millions of businesses for a variety of reasons. It?s made life easier by enabling meetings without the constraints of distance and time.

Conference Call Services - Easy, Cheap, Effective

Conference call services are service providers facilitating conference call facilities to all those who want to perform an audio or web conference at a short notice. The clients can avail their services for a definite fee - that may vary from service provider to provider - and the users in turn are offered the best of services and support all through the session. The costs of a session are generally affordable, especially when compared with the expenses of a business travel and hotel accommodations, but may vary from one provider to the other. But, irrespective of the service provider, at the end of the day, the user may find that conference call services are the most cost effective way to arrange a trans-continental business meeting.

The conference call services - as offered by the conference call service providers - vary from simple audio conferencing to web conferencing, and each comes with different schemes and special offers. Audio conference call services or audio conference calls are for those who want to communicate things verbally, the same way as one does in a round table meeting, without any visual data exchange. On the other hand, web conference calling involves not only talking, but the participants can also see each other and share a document or parts of a document online if wished so. Audio conference call services are usually charged on a per minute basis while online conference calls levies a fee on a per seat per month basis. It may be $100-150 for a web conference session on an average and $60 for audio conferencing. Concessional rates may be offered to those who are using these conference call services quite frequently.
